培育抗寒高产的橡胶优良新品种是我国选育种工作的特色.利用抗寒前哨梯度试验是利用空间,争取时间加速选育抗寒高产品种提供有效的鉴定手段.近年来,由于冬期气候偏暖,地处闽南漳州的试验点难于比较无性系间耐寒水平的差异,给橡胶抗寒选育种工作选成时间和物力的浪费.在纬度较北的试种区如惠安、仙游及永春前哨点,由于地理位置的差别,在一般年份的冬期,日均温≤12℃的天数和负积温有着明显的差异且从南往北逐渐增多.据省热作气象试验站统计分析,在25个气象因子中,日均温≤12℃的天数和负积温,二个因子相关系数最高且与胶树4~6级的生产性寒害最密切.这两个因子能较好地
